In celebrating four hundrend years of the London stage, Brian Masters brings to life the great actors of the past and recreates their impact in performance, from Thomas Betterton to David Garrick, Edmund Kean, Mrs. Siddons, Henry Livings, to this century with John Gielgud and Laurence Olivier. He says that the work of great actors does not die with them, but is re-experienced in the performances of today s actors.
